Dean railway station, also shown as Dean, serves the village of West Dean in Wiltshire, England. The station is on the Wessex Main Line, 88 miles 10 chains from London Waterloo. Dean railway station is situated 2 miles northwest of Little Common Field.

Whiteparish Common is a 64.5 hectare biological Site of Special Scientific Interest near Whiteparish, Wiltshire, England, notified in 1965. Whiteparish Common is situated 1½ miles southwest of Little Common Field.

Whiteparish is a village and civil parish on the A27 about 7.5 miles southeast of Salisbury in Wiltshire, England. The village is about 1.5 miles from the county boundary with Hampshire. The parish includes the hamlets of Cowesfield Green and Newton. Whiteparish is situated 1½ miles west of Little Common Field.

East Dean is a civil parish and small village in the Test Valley district of Hampshire, England, about 6 miles northwest of Romsey. The village is mentioned in the Domesday Book as "Dene", appears as "Estdena" in 1167, and as "Dune" in 1212. East Dean is situated 1½ miles north of Little Common Field.

Sherfield English is a small village and civil parish in the Test Valley borough of Hampshire, England. It is located on the A27 road, around 4 miles west of Romsey. Sherfield English is situated 1½ miles southeast of Little Common Field.
